$500,000 CASH BLOWOUT! is a $50 scratch-off ticket from the Florida state lottery. Its current expected value is 78.8%, up 0.4 percentage points from the launch value of 78.4%. 48 of the original 100 $500,000 top prizes are still unclaimed. Approximately 55% of the 26.3M printed tickets have been sold.
